Sign Business Workshop
Our weekend business workshop has been set for May 17.
We will be introducing a few local router sign business to other general sign shops in the community. It seems few general sign shops know what can be done with a CNC and have no idea how to place and order. Not to mention what the services will cost them. Our workshop will be getting these folks together to share idea's of what can be done and where the needs are.
One of our attendees is a sign sandblast sign company while another business will discuss installation techniques and pricing. One company is expanding into dimensional signage but doesn't have any equipment for routing. Then there will be a few demonstrations and examples of what can be done with traditional materials like PVC. Lots of Fun.
Gary Beckwith will be discussing some pricing guidelines and sales techniques. That's always a treat. This will be a round-house weekend with each company bringing samples of what they do best and giving hints about pricing.
This is a business to business weekend that is long overdue. There are lots of CNC businesses who struggle finding their market, while at the same time have little experience sales, pricing and advertising.
When we announced this workshop a couple of months ago it filled up immediately. At this point we have nine people attending with two out of state. Just the right size for one on one work. The price is free!
